Emerson Theater Collaborative Announces
Hour Farther – a Reading
August 16 - 17, 2013, Mystic CT…Emerson Theatre Collaborative (ETC) announces Hour Farther – a Reading written by David H. Greer and produced by Camilla Ross. Hour Farther, set outside a rural Kentucky town, is a six-actor, 19-character ensemble play about Victor, an adopted-son waiting to meet his biological father for the first time. As he waits, Victor takes us on an odyssey with individuals who were father-figures to him: his adopted father, mother, and grandfather, as well as his reverend, step-cousin, step-dad, even Superman and Jesus. However, the spirit of Victor's deceased twin brother reveals a dark family tragedy that unleashes a wrath in him that may woefully ruin the meeting with his father. Or is it a truth he already knows? An epic play with cosmic and biblical tones told through rural, gospel, and hip hop rhythms, Hour Farther explores the notion: is blood thicker than water?

Readings will be performed August 16 & 17 at 7:00 pm at First United Methodist Church in Mystic. Tickets are $10 and can be purchased at the door.
